Please help!!!<br><br> What is the measure of ∠DCB?<br> Enter answer below<br> __
Tom [10]

Answer:

m<DCB = 84°

Step-by-step explanation:

ABCD is a parallelogram since it has two sets of parallel sides.

Opposite angles in a parallelogram are congruent.

Consecutive angles in a parallelogram are supplementary.

<DCB is consecutive to <D.

m<DCB + m<D = 180°

m<DCB + 96° = 180°

m<DCB = 84°

Which of the following statements best describes the relationship between a line and a point in a plane? exactly one plane conta
Alexandra [31]

Answer: (b) exactly one plane contains a given line and a point not on the line.


Step-by-step explanation: The basic postulates of geometry are very-well known to all of us. For example-

(i) The intersection of two lines determines a point,

(ii) Two parallel lines give result to a plane,

(iii) A line and a point not on the line determines a plane, etc...

Thus, with the help of the third point, we can easily arrive at the conclusion that a given line and a point not lying on the line is contained in a plane. For example- see the attached figure, AB is a line and P is any point not on the line. They both contained in the plane ABC.

Hence, the correct option is (b).
